RED CROSS BOXES The American Junior Red Cross asked the school to prepare fifty boxes to be sent to poverty stricken people for Christmas. The boxes are small but they hold a surprising number of items. They bear the words "Grcetitigs from the American Junior Red Cross." The boxes are sent to Europe and to the Facific. These are some thing's that are listed to be put in the boxes; three pencils, three small pads, a cake of soap, a toothbrush, toothpaste. These are the things that are in great demand in those countries. The seventh grade was asked to fill the boxes, which they have done. The Home Economics Club will check them on Wednesday, November 5 under the direction of Miss Henderson and Mrs. Carlson. KICK PIN The kick pin baseball season came to an end last Thursday when the energetic Sophomore girls defeated de-feated the outnumbered Seniors 27 to 20. Both teams exhibited en-' en-' thusiasm and a determination to win that characterizes all Pleasant Grove teams. j The game was refereed by Ard-ena Ard-ena Beck who displayed impartiality impartial-ity that was very exemplary. This game left the Sophomores i with the title of Champions in Kick pin baseball for this year. Tnvnr HOME EC. The Home Ec. Club of the P.G.H. S. has planned a banquet for this year's football team.
